ECE students told to motivate children

Correspondent

VIZIANAGARAM: G.S.N. Raju, Dean, Department of Electronics and Communication Engineering, Andhra University, underlined the need to pursue innovative technologies for the benefit of the society. Addressing the gathering at the inaugural function of National- level students technical symposium - SPACETECH-07 at MVGR College of Engineering here on Wednesday, he said, following vast development in communication technology, engineering students could motivate young children to come up with new ideas, and suggested internship before completing their course.

P.L.P. Raju, member, college governing body, who inaugurated the symposium, suggested that students visit schools in rural areas and kindle their enthusiasm in the field of electronics and communication. K.V.L. Raju, Principal, said more than 500 technical papers from colleges across the country were received for the SPACETECH. While detailing the application of various electronic mechanisms in the field of remote sensing, mapping, bio-medical etc, he said education must have social relevance.
